1

1. A line card for use in a communications network node having a plurality of line cards, said line card, in use, being in communication with a routing processor shared by the line cards, said line card comprising: one or more line interfaces for connection to communication lines in a communications network, said interfaces being arranged to receive network packets addressed to nodes in said communications network; one or more interfaces arranged to transmit network packets processed by said line card to another of said line cards; said line card being arranged in operation to: i) receive a network state update via a communications line terminating at the line card; ii) pass said network state update to the shared routing processor for input into a routing process run by the shared routing processor which occasionally generates a set of routes for use by the line card; iii) receive said set of routes from said shared routing processor; and iv) route incoming packets on the basis of the received set of routes; said line card being arranged to further respond to receiving a network state update by calculating one or more interim routes taking said received network state update into account, and routing incoming packets over said interim routes until said set of routes is received from said shared routing processor.

2

2. A line card according to claim 1 wherein said line card is further arranged to calculate said one or more interim routes only on finding said network state update to be likely to impact the routing of packets arriving at the line card.

3

3. A line card according to claim 1 wherein said interim routing calculation calculates a route for one or more destination addresses found in one or more packets which arrive at said line card between the receipt of said network state update and the receipt of said set of routes.

4

4. A line card according to claim 1 further comprising bespoke hardware for performing said interim routing calculation.

5

5. A line card according to claim 4 wherein said bespoke hardware comprises a field programmable gate array programmed to perform said interim routing calculation.

6

6. A line card according to claim 4 wherein said bespoke hardware comprises an application-specific integrated circuit.

7

7. A router comprising a line card according to claim 1 .

8

8. A method of operating a line card for use in a router having a plurality of line cards, said line card, in use, being in communication with a routing processor shared by the line cards, said method comprising: operating said line card to: i) receive a network state update from another router via a communications line terminating at the line card; ii) pass said network state update to said routing processor for input into a routing process run by the shared routing processor which occasionally generates a set of routes for use by the line cards; iii) receive said set of routes from said shared routing processor; and iv) route incoming packets on the basis of the received set of routes; said method further comprising operating said line card to further respond to receiving a network state update by calculating one or more interim routes taking said received network state update into account, and routing incoming packets over said interim routes until said set of routes is received from said shared routing processor.

9

9. A non-transitory machine readable storage medium tangibly embodying a program of instructions executable by one or more processors on said line card to operate said line card in accordance with the method of claim 8 .

10

10. The method according to claim 8 further comprising: operating said line card to calculate said one or more interim routes only on finding said network state update to be likely to impact the routing of packets arriving at the line card.

11

11. The method according to claim 8 wherein said calculating one or more of the interim routes includes calculating a route for one or more destination addresses found in one or more packets which arrive at said line card between the receipt of said network state update and the receipt of said set of routes.
